#b54f54 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b54f54 is composed of 71% red, 31% green and 32.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 56.4% magenta, 53.6% yellow and 29% black. It has a hue angle of 357.1 degrees, a saturation of 40.8% and a lightness of 51%. #b54f54 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ff9ea8 with #6b0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6666.

Shades and Tints of #b54f54

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040102 is the darkest color, while #fbf5f5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#b54f54

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#857f7f is the less saturated color, while #f80c17 is the most saturated one.
